-Moved-
Flash this update_plugin.prx to flash0: vsh\nodule overwriting the original update_plugin.prx.
This will make the network update icon into a reboot/recovery shutdown icon. You can then extract the network update icon from topmenu_plugin.rco and edit the text if you want:
